With a multifunction cable tester you can perform a range of tests that you would normally need a few different testers to do. You can do wire-mapping‚ test for the length of the cable‚ test the attenuation‚ and you can test NEXT (near end crosstalk) for copper cables. They will also test for optical power and

    two kinds of surrogate monkey mother machines‚ both equipped to dispense milk. One mother was made out of bare wire mesh. The other was a wire mother covered with soft terry cloth. Harlow’s first observation was that monkeys who had a choice of mothers spent far more time clinging to the terry cloth surrogates‚ even when their physical nourishment came from bottles mounted on the bare wire mothers.
